Weekly BioRollerCoaster: On Monday 2-5-00 Biotechnology stocks continued their descent from the previous week, with the BTK slipping 1% from Friday's close. With Monday's close, biotech stocks had continuously declined for five trading sessions. This trend was reversed on Tuesday with the BTK gaining 4% for the day. However on Wednesday through Friday, biotechnology indices traded slightly down to mixed depending on announcements made for individual stocks. For example, during the week a major DNA chip and gene probe manufacturer reported increased revenues, narrowed loses, and strong demand for its products. On the other hand, concerns were expresses about a possible slowdown in the revenues from the licensing of databases from another company. The BioBizNet Select Index (BBNSI) was down 2.85% for the week. The Amex Biotechnology Index (^BTK on Yahoo, BTK.X on SI) ended the week off 0.39%. For individual stocks see biobiznet.com
